Peponi Hotel, Lamu Island

Lamu island is the very root of Swahili culture in East Africa, which centuries ago spread down the coast from the north. A little paradise one should visit at least once!

Peponi is a small hotel offering 24 guest rooms divided into superior and standard rooms. They all have ocean views, the difference between them is the location, size and private outside area. All rooms have fans, mosquito nets, showers, personal safe and fresh flowers. Each room is different and 5 of them are built right on the beach.

A swimming pool is available under two baobab trees facing the ocean and the beach is one the few remaining untouched beaches in the Kenyan coastline, the spectacular Shela Beach with 12 kilometers of white sands and dunes offering excellent swimming and an idyllic setting for a walk at dawn or sunset.

Peponi offers great cuisine and stunning settings to enjoy it. Only fresh ingredients are used and they offer a good variety of dishes wether it be fresh seafood, sushi or traditional Swahili style cooking.

The bar offers a great opportunity to meet Shela habitants and to enjoy their signature cocktail ‘Old Pal’.
